Default Carbing Lower tie bars

Well I had installed a 6 point front lower tie bar and a 2 point rear. The car handles like a champ in the corners. By body flex in the front at all. The car slides around corners nicely. Can make quick changes in steering, with out the car having to roll at all now. I give the carbing lower tie bars a 10 on review.
